To obtain the first (initial) digit, here are the formulas: These formulas assume cell A1 contains the number in question. Excel =LEFT(TEXT(A1, 0# ),1) Open Office =LEFT(TEXT(A1; 0# );1) To obtain the Odd or Even of a cell's content, here are the formulas: These formulas assume cell G1 contains the number (or in your case, digit) in question.
